The PAC1934T-I/JQ by Microchip Technology represents a state-of-the-art four-channel precision power and energy monitoring IC designed to meet the evolving needs of power monitoring in various applications. With the ability to monitor multiple power rails concurrently, it offers the flexibility required for modern system designs, making it suitable for applications such as servers, networking equipment, and industrial systems. Equipped with an integrated 16-bit ADC, this IC delivers high-resolution measurements, ensuring precise monitoring of voltage, current, power, and energy consumption. Its I2C interface facilitates seamless communication with microcontrollers and other digital devices, simplifying data retrieval and configuration. Additionally, the PAC1934T-I/JQ incorporates advanced features including programmable alert thresholds and on-chip accumulated energy registers, streamlining power management processes. Its compact form factor and low power consumption make it an excellent choice for integration into compact and energy-efficient designs, offering both performance and sustainability
Description | Quad DC Power/Energy Monitor with Accumulator | Vsense min FSR (mV) | -100 |
Vsense max FSR (mV) | 100 | Vsense accuracy (% FSR, max) | 0.9 |
Vbus Range min (V) | 0 | Vbus Range max (V) | 32 |
Vbus accuracy (% FSR, max) | 0.5 | Sampling Interval min (msec) | 0.98 |
Sampling Interval max (msec) | 125 | Remote Temperature Monitors | 0 |
Temperature Accuracy Max (°) | 0 | Alert/Therm | 0 |
Interface | SMBus/I2C | Address Select | 16 |
# Current Channel | 4 | ADC Resolution (bit) | 16 |
